Ingredients
- 1 lb large raw shrimp (deveined)
- 1 cup white or brown rice
- 2 cups water
- 1 cup chopped fresh vegetables (e.g., bell peppers, cucumbers, avocado)
- ½ cup m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ons sriracha sauce
- Low-sodium soy sauce (for drizzling)
Instructions
- Prepare your ingredients: Wash and chop vegetables into bite-sized pieces; rinse shrimp under cold water.
- Cook the rice: In a saucepan, combine rice and water; bring to boil, then reduce heat to low and cover for 15 minutes until tender.
- Cook the shrimp: In a skillet over medium-high heat, heat oil and cook shrimp for 3-4 minutes until pink and opaque.
- Mix spicy mayo: Combine mayonnaise and sriracha in a bowl; adjust spice level to taste.
- Assemble your bowls: Fluff rice and divide it among serving bowls; top with cooked shrimp and vegetables.
- Drizzle with sauce: Finish by drizzling spicy mayo over each bowl; serve warm.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
